Candidate 3: Prometheus Hard Piston

Prometheus, the mechbox parts division of LayLax, is widely regarded as the provider of best mechbox parts available. This reputation was built on the impressive custom AEGs sold through First Factory, many of which use exclusively Prometheus parts when possible. The Prometheus Hard Piston displays the largest deviation from "standard" piston design through the inclusion of reinforcement rails alongside each plastic tooth. These rails strengthen each tooth by tying them all together, theoretically improving their ability to withstand increased loads. The Prometheus Hard Piston also uses 7 metal teeth, a large departure from the standard 1 tooth design. Cursory examination of the piston shows average molding quality with some molding lines visible.


Piston: Prometheus Hard Piston
Weight: 0.6oz
Piston Material: unconfirmed
Metal Teeth: 7
Average Barcol Hardness (piston): 11.0
Average Barcol Hardness (tooth): 87.1
Tapered Lip: yes
Distinguishing Feature: reinforced plastic teeth, 7 metal teeth


Although the picture is fuzzy, one can clearly make out the guide rails molded as part of the teeth to provide support.
